The WEILER 50141 is a Type 27 ceramic flap disc from the Tiger Ceramic HD series, designed for aggressive material removal and long service life on angle grinders. Built with a high-density coated ceramic abrasive at 80 grit, this disc delivers consistent cut rates on hard metals and heat-sensitive alloys where conventional alumina discs fall short. The phenolic backing plate provides rigidity and stability under load. It fits a 5/8 inches-11 threaded arbor and runs at a maximum operating speed of 8,600 RPM. Licensed tradespeople performing weld blending, surface conditioning, and stock removal on structural steel, stainless, and hard alloys rely on this disc for sustained performance through demanding work cycles.
The WEILER 50141 is suited for heavy-duty grinding applications in fabrication shops, industrial maintenance, and field ironwork. The Type 27 flat profile makes it well matched for flat surface work and inside corners where a raised-hub disc would be cumbersome. High-density flap construction extends disc life and maintains an aggressive cut from first use through the final flap. The 80 grit medium grade balances material removal rate with surface finish, making it practical across weld blending, rust removal, and edge chamfering tasks.
Designed as a direct-mount replacement or standard-use flap disc for 7-inch angle grinders equipped with a 5/8 inches-11 threaded spindle.
Flap disc mounting and use should be performed by trained personnel following ANSI B7.1 and applicable workplace safety standards. Always confirm the grinder spindle speed does not exceed the disc maximum operating speed of 8,600 RPM before mounting. Inspect the disc for damage before each use and never operate a cracked or delaminated disc. Wear appropriate PPE including a face shield, gloves, and hearing protection during grinding operations.
